If the python package is hosted on Github, you can install directly from Github:
Installation from Github
pip install git+https://github.com/aspose-pdf-cloud/aspose-pdf-cloud-python.git
Package Manager Console Command
pip install asposepdfcloud
Steps to encrypt PDF via Python SDK
Aspose.PDF Cloud developers can easily load & encrypt PDF in just a few lines of code.
- Install Python SDK.
- Go to the Aspose Cloud Dashboard.
- Encrypt the file with AES-256 using base64-encoded passwords.
- Download the secured PDF back to a local folder.
Encrypt PDF using Python
import shutil
import json
import logging
from pathlib import Path
import base64
from asposepdfcloud import ApiClient, PdfApi, CryptoAlgorithm
# Configure logging
logging.basicConfig(level=logging.INFO, format="%(asctime)s - %(levelname)s - %(message)s")
class Config:
"""Configuration parameters."""
CREDENTIALS_FILE = Path(r"C:\\Projects\\ASPOSE\\Pdf.Cloud\\Credentials\\credentials.json")
LOCAL_FOLDER = Path(r"C:\Samples")
P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ME = "sample.pdf"
LOCAL_RESULT_DOCUMENT_NAME = "output_sample.pdf"
ENCRYPT_ALGORITHM = CryptoAlgorithm.AESX256
USER_PASSWORD = 'User-Password'
OWNER_PASSWORD = 'Owner-Password'
class pdfEncryption:
"""Class for managing PDF encryption using Aspose PDF Cloud API."""
def __init__(self, credentials_file: Path = Config.CREDENTIALS_FILE):
self.pdf_api = None
self._init_api(credentials_file)
def _init_api(self, credentials_file: Path):
"""Initialize the API client."""
try:
with credentials_file.open("r", encoding="utf-8") as file:
credentials = json.load(file)
api_key, app_id = credentials.get("key"), credentials.get("id")
if not api_key or not app_id:
raise ValueError("init_api(): Error: Missing API keys in the credentials file.")
self.pdf_api = PdfApi(ApiClient(api_key, app_id))
except (FileNotFoundError, json.JSONDecodeError, ValueError) as e:
logging.error(f"init_api(): Failed to load credentials: {e}")
def upload_document(self):
""" Upload a PDF document to the Aspose Cloud server. """
if self.pdf_api:
file_path = Config.LOCAL_FOLDER / Config.P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ME
try:
self.pdf_api.upload_file(Config.P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ME, str(file_path))
logging.info(f"upload_file(): File '{Config.P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ME}' uploaded successfully.")
except Exception as e:
logging.error(f"upload_document(): Failed to upload file: {e}")
def download_result(self):
""" Download the processed PDF document from the Aspose Cloud server. """
if self.pdf_api:
try:
temp_file = self.pdf_api.download_file(Config.P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ME)
local_path = Config.LOCAL_FOLDER / Config.LOCAL_RESULT_DOCUMENT_NAME
shutil.move(temp_file, str(local_path))
logging.info(f"download_result(): File successfully downloaded: {local_path}")
except Exception as e:
logging.error(f"download_result(): Failed to download file: {e}")
def encrypt_document(self):
"""Encrypt the PDF document."""
if self.pdf_api:
try:
user_password_encoded = base64.b64encode(bytes(Config.USER_PASSWORD, encoding='utf-8'))
owner_password_encoded = base64.b64encode(bytes(Config.OWNER_PASSWORD, encoding='utf-8'))
response = self.pdf_api.post_encrypt_document_in_storage(Config.P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ME, user_password_encoded, owner_password_encoded, Config.ENCRYPT_ALGORITHM)
if response.code == 200:
logging.info(f"encrypt_document(): Document #{Config.P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ME} successfully encrypted.")
else:
logging.error(f"encrypt_document(): Failed to encrypt document #{Config.PDF_DOCUMENT_NAME}. Response code: {response.code}")
except Exception as e:
logging.error(f"aencrypt_document(): Error while encrypted document: {e}")
if __name__ == "__main__":
pdf_encrypt = pdfEncryption()
pdf_encrypt.upload_document()
pdf_encrypt.encrypt_document()
pdf_encrypt.download_result()
